● Review proposed BIP322 for generic message signing: this recently-proposed BIP will enable customers to create signed messages for all currently-used kinds of Bitcoin addresses, together with P2PKH, P2SH, P2SH-wrapped segwit, P2WPKH, and P2WSH. But when you’re trying to replicate a hash by understanding when you recognize the input message before the hash, the pre-image, then it’s only a 128-bit safety because you type of have to search out two things that produce the same digest reasonably than needing to replicate one digest. A typical Bitcoin transaction utilizing P2WPKH inputs and outputs contains one input from the spender of about 67 vbytes and two outputs of about 31 vbytes every, one to the receiver and one as change again to the spender. In a mailing checklist post, bip-tapscript creator Pieter Wuille notes that he and Andrew Poelstra examined other resource limits on scripts that have been put in place to forestall nodes from using an excessive amount of CPU or memory throughout verification.
First one, HWI 2.3.0, which has just a few items from the discharge notes that I think are value speaking about. The second merchandise from the discharge notes was the ability to, within the GUI, import and export PSBTs to and from a file. Mark Erhardt: Yeah, so for this one, we have now a small replace for how PSBTs are shown in the GUI. In step one, multiple small inputs are consolidated right into a single bigger input utilizing gradual (however low-feerate) transactions that spend the service’s cash back to itself. Even with out sensible contracts thats a first. Smart Bitcoin Cash (SmartBCH) is a sidechain for Bitcoin Cash and has an intention to explore new ideas and unlock possibilities. A bank card additionally differs from a money card, which can be used like forex by the owner of the card. Supporting over 65 fiat currencies, together with payment choices via debit card, bank card, financial institution transfer, and more, users are spoiled for alternative, though it's important to note that the choices out there vary by jurisdiction. Whereas the previous transaction used all 140 vbytes to pay a single receiver, the batched transaction uses only about fifty three vbytes per receiver-a bit over 60% savings per cost
>
These funds monitor bitcoin futures contracts, which include the extra costs of rolling over contracts on settlement days. And we’ve lined rather a lot of these PRs as they have been merged to the LDK repository over the previous couple of weeks. Mike Schmidt: The next release we coated is LDK 0.0.116, which adds assist for anchor outputs and multipath funds with keysend. Mike Schmidt: Next question from the Stack Exchange is, "How do route hints have an effect on pathfinding? I think that LND had a different habits when the best way they used the route hints was totally different, and would actually make route enhance not work. This increases the number of funds users could make and so, given fixed demand, can make it extra affordable to send Bitcoin funds. So, you may sort of ask that individuals route by way of specific channels as a result of that one is very lopsided and it might transfer the liquidity more within the course that might stability out the channel, which can be a good thing. Realistically, the more a transaction spends, the extra doubtless it is to wish additional inputs. If we assume that consolidation transactions can pay only 20% of the feerate of a standard transaction and can consolidate a hundred inputs at a time, we will calculate the financial savings of utilizing the two-step process for our one input per output scenario above (while displaying, for comparability, the simple finest-case situation of already having a big input out there
p>
Services that discover themselves ceaselessly utilizing a couple of input per transaction may be ready to increase their financial savings using a two-step process. To this point, the GUI would not point out in case you had been utilizing - oh, sorry, may you hear me? In the second step, the service spends from certainly one of its consolidated inputs utilizing payment batching and achieves the best-case efficiency described above. For the typical case, consolidation loses effectivity when only making a single fee, however when batching a number of funds, it performs nearly as well as the perfect case state of affairs. As of January 2021, payment batching is utilized by multiple fashionable Bitcoin companies (primarily exchanges), is out there as a built-in function of many wallets (including Bitcoin Core), and should be easy to implement in custom wallets and cost-sending solutions. In abstract, payment batching supplies significant savings for companies that usually have inputs obtainable which can be 5 to 20 occasions bigger than their typical output. In addition to fee batching immediately providing a charge financial savings, batching additionally uses the limited block area more effectively by lowering the number of vbytes per fee. But there’s also this method that Christian Decker mentioned in his answer to this question on the Stack Exchange, which is route increase, which signifies that I also can present some form of hints about channels that look what i found’m conscious of that have ample capability for the fee that I wish to receive.